Monitor Size Guide

So you're looking at 27-inch 3.56 aspect ratio monitor versus 23-inch 1.33 aspect ratio monitor? Let's break down what that means for your setup. You'll notice quite a difference in workspace with the 23-inch 1.33 aspect ratio monitor giving you roughly 34% more screen real estate. You'll get a wider field of view with the 27-inch 3.56 aspect ratio compared to the 23-inch 1.33 aspect ratio. Whether you're comparing 27 inch super ultrawide vs 23 inch standard or just starting your research, finding the right monitor makes a huge difference in your daily experience. A lot of people find that 27-inch screens offer that perfect balance—enough space without overwhelming your desk. If you're constantly flipping between documents or programs, you'll probably appreciate having dual screens to spread everything out. On the flip side, ultrawide monitors give you that seamless panoramic view that's perfect for video editing, gaming, or just enjoying content without a bezel down the middle.
